

Today we’d like to introduce you to Ryan Waters.
Hi Ryan, thanks for joining us today. We’d love for you to start by introducing yourself.
I was an athlete my entire to the collegiate level. After graduating from college with a business management degree, I was lost, and I did not know what I wanted to do with my life. I did know I wanted to start a business but didn’t at the time have the funds to do so. I ran into a college buddy who convinced me to quit my sales job and start personal training for him at 24-hour fitness. I fell in love with it, and 15 years later, I’m still at it on my 3rd gym upgrade, learning new lessons and growing my knowledge base each time.
Can you talk to us about the challenges and lessons you’ve learned along the way? Would you say it’s been easy or smooth in retrospect?
No, it hasn’t been a smooth ride. I made a lot of mistakes and learned a lot of lessons during that time. Some of the struggles have been staffing issues and experiencing burnout as a personal trainer due to early morning and long days to work with clients’ schedules.
Great, so let’s talk business. Can you tell our readers more about what you do and what you think sets you apart from others?
At 1hundred, we offer 8-week fitness and nutrition programs that give you 100% of the tools you need to be healthier and happier. We take the guessing game out of your healthy lifestyle journey and help you get stronger mentally and physically. We provide small group personal training, meal planning, goal setting, and supplement support. We recently rebranded and restructured our services to provide our members with the knowledge and support they need to succeed. We are also 1hundred because we only allow 100 members to be in our program simultaneously. Before the remodel, we were revolving doors of people coming in for just a workout. As quantity increased, service decreased, and we couldn’t have that anymore. On Christmas Eve of 2021, we canceled 300 memberships and started fresh with programs that are 15 years in the making. After working with thousands of clients, we’ve developed a rock-solid program that has massively increased our member’s results and accountability without the extremely high cost and scheduling limitations of 1 on 1 personal training. We selected 8 weeks at a time to run our programs because that is a long enough time to see measurable results but not too long to fall off the wagon. Every 8 weeks, we do a performance review and set the goals for the next 8 weeks correcting anything that was not working in the previous program.
